Sardine for Breakfast

Sardine for Breakfast: A Savory Start to Your Day

Enjoy a protein-packed start to your day with Sardine for Breakfast, featuring omega-3-rich sardines and eggs.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 2 servings
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: Mediterranean
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Base
  • 1 can Canned Sardines Skinless and boneless preferred
  • 1 tablespoon Olive Oil Can swap with another cooking oil
  • 1 medium Onion Sauté until translucent
  • 2 medium Fresh Tomatoes Can substitute with canned tomatoes
  • 2 cloves Garlic Minced
  • 1 tablespoon Tomato Paste
  • 4 large Eggs Cook until whites are set
  • 1 teaspoon Salt To taste
Optional Toppings
  • 1 tablespoon Fresh Parsley Chopped
  • 1 wedge Lemon For squeezing

Equipment

  • Skillet

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Quick Protein-Packed Sardine and Eggs Breakfast
  1. Heat the olive oil in a medium skillet over medium heat until shimmering.
  2. Add the sliced onions and sauté for 5-7 minutes until translucent.
  3. Add chopped fresh tomatoes and cook for 3 minutes, stirring frequently.
  4. Stir in the minced garlic and sauté for 30 seconds until fragrant.
  5. Add tomato paste and cook for 2 minutes, stirring gently.
  6. Pour in half a cup of water to deglaze the skillet and let simmer for 1-2 minutes.
  7. Gently add the canned sardines, breaking them slightly, and stir in the remaining water.
  8. Create small wells and crack the eggs into them, cover, and cook for 3-4 minutes.
  9. Season with salt and garnish with parsley if desired.
  10. Serve immediately while warm.

Notes

For best results, add the sardines near the end of cooking and be careful with the garlic to prevent bitterness.
